Transaction 80c655055ecc59d4bf45f4e606db649c094ed82760afbe6810e49ef8e7c5f717

1 Input
2 Outputs
  • 80c655055ecc59d4bf45f4e606db649c094ed82760afbe6810e49ef8e7c5f717:0
  • value  3220054
    address  1HMf8ihMD4F9uD33J8N2iyemmhtQv4VZTV
  • 80c655055ecc59d4bf45f4e606db649c094ed82760afbe6810e49ef8e7c5f717:1
  • value  48053447
    address  3QHUWKMcPK6x4moPTidRvW83FCVQ37VmsK